Subject: Catalog cache cut-over done

Team — the Bramblefort catalog moved to event-driven invalidation last night. TTL-based expiry is gone. Writes now publish invalidation events; edge nodes drop keys within seconds instead of minutes. Stale-read complaints should stop. Known gap: bulk imports still flush the whole namespace — fix tracked separately. Rollback path stays live for two weeks. If you're debugging cache behavior, start with the event consumer logs. Current production settings follow.

deployment values, bagaf-kagag:
istael:
  pin: 2777
  tenant: tamvan
  seal: seal_75cefd5e
  metrics_host: metrics.istael.qirvanio.example
  standby_team: holion
  escalation: kelmir-drudor
  nonce: d13cd7

Account recovery — Feedwright validator. Plugin authors: if your Feedwright account locks after failed validator runs, file a reset via the Perchly console, wait for the grace timer, then re-authenticate. Scoped tokens are revoked automatically. To restore your signing profile from the escrow snapshot, supply the recovery passphrase directly below.

vault phrase of fahog-yajog = frawyn-jordor-casael-gormir-olieth-julmir

During the incident, Quillhopper emitted roughly 40x its normal log rate, which saturated the ingestion pipeline and delayed alerts for unrelated services. New team members should know this service is intentionally sampled at 5% for INFO-level logs; do not raise the sampling rate without a capacity review. We will codify the sampling config in the shared observability module by next sprint. The sampling policy and override procedure are documented here.

wiki page, bawef-hafop: https://jira.nelvroworks.corp/job/pages/projects/7c5c0f440dbd

Hey plugin folks — quick note on health checks. Our Perchgate load balancer pings /healthz on every instance of the Lanternfold gateway every five seconds, and it'll yank your plugin's node out of rotation after three failures. So make sure your handler responds fast and doesn't block on downstream calls. For the health endpoint to report upstream status, your local instance needs credentials for the status aggregator. Drop the following line into your .env and restart.

env line for kageg-fajof: COURIER_KEY5=93d14